Understanding Energy-Efficient Windows

Energy-efficient windows are engineered to limit the transfer of heat between your home’s inside and outdoors. Central to this technology are features such as low-emissivity (Low-E) glass coatings that reflect infrared energy, multi-pane designs that trap air or gas between glass sheets, and insulated frames constructed with modern materials. By minimizing unwanted heat gain in summer and heat loss in winter, these windows help keep living areas more comfortable year-round.

Benefits of Upgrading to Energy-Efficient Windows

There are multiple practical reasons for homeowners to choose energy-efficient windows:
• Reduced Energy Costs: Insulated windows keep your heating and cooling systems from working overtime. According to the U.S. Department of Energy, up to 30 percent of residential heating and cooling energy use can be attributed to heat gain and loss through windows.
• Improved Comfort: Consistent indoor temperatures and fewer drafts make living spaces cozier year-round.
• Noise Reduction: Thicker glass and airspaces in high-efficiency windows help block out exterior noise, providing a quieter home environment, especially important in urban or noisy neighborhoods.
• Lower Environmental Impact: Efficient windows reduce energy use, helping lower your home’s carbon emissions and contributing to sustainability efforts.

Key Features to Look For

It is important to recognize the specific technologies that make windows perform more efficiently:
• Low-E Glass: A virtually invisible coating that minimizes the amount of UV and infrared light passing through glass without compromising visible light.
• Multiple Glazing Layers: Double or triple-pane windows, often filled with inert gases such as argon or krypton between panes, substantially increase insulation.
• Insulated Frames: Modern materials like vinyl, fiberglass, or composite frames outperform traditional wood or aluminum in terms of sealing and insulation.
• High-Quality Seals: Properly sealed windows with advanced spacers further limit air leaks, enhancing overall performance.

Choosing the Right Windows for Your Home

Not all windows are created equal. Choosing the best option for your home involves a few key factors:
• Regional Climate: Selection should be based on your local climate’s demands. In colder climates, look for a lower U-factor rating, which quantifies heat loss. Warm regions benefit from windows with higher solar heat gain coefficient (SHGC) ratings.
• Style and Appearance: Design matters. New windows should complement your property’s design, enhance curb appeal, and deliver performance benefits.
• Trusted Certifications: Look for windows that carry ENERGY STAR certification and ratings from the National Fenestration Rating Council (NFRC). These ensure that products meet stringent energy-efficiency standards.

Installation and Maintenance Tips

For the best results, it is critical to have energy-efficient windows installed by experienced professionals. Proper installation guarantees airtight seals and optimal performance. After installation, regular maintenance, such as checking the seals, lubricating hardware, and cleaning the glass, will help preserve window longevity and efficiency. Financial Incentives and Rebates

Upgrading to high-efficiency windows can come with an upfront cost, but homeowners have access to valuable rebates and incentives. The Inflation Reduction Act provides a federal tax credit of up to 30 percent (with a cap of $1,200 per year) for qualifying energy-efficient home improvements, including window replacements.
